I'm thinking of building another Nova but not sure what engine to pick.
I want it to be faster than my last one which was a ph2 c20let (291bhp) but I don't want a LET this time because I hated the lack of room in the engine bay.
I want to aim for about 350ish bhp, only engine I can think of is a c20ne turbo conversion.
What would you suggest?
